Output 592e5025fcdf6649d39af3837feb3e6972e7bdfa7ff123ad821abd8a64a04d2c:0

value
12986
script pubkey
OP_0 OP_PUSHBYTES_20 c8b5b3372bb0057dc27d0f13cb77e6517e263eb8
address
bc1qez6mxdetkqzhmsnapufukalx29lzv04cthv4kx
transaction
592e5025fcdf6649d39af3837feb3e6972e7bdfa7ff123ad821abd8a64a04d2c
spent
true